摘要
Landscape indices are popular for the quantification of landscape pattern. But all landscape indices beingused so far are scalar quantity, which measure patterns without consideringsufficiently the pattern size and the direc-tionality together. Based on planar characteristics defined in mechanics such as centroid, moment of inertia,product ofinertia, principal axes and so on, vector analysis theory on landscape pattern (VATLP) is exPloredhere. Firstly we es-tablish a coordinate system of centroidal principal axes (CSCPA) of a patch or patches. Some related new indices in-cludingthose describingthe direction of patterndistribution (patch orientation (PO), vecctoriapatch orientation(VPO)), and those indicating the shape of patch's equivalent ellipse (major axis (MJA), minor axis (MIA) and ec-centric rate (ER)) are deduced.Tese landscape metrics are then applied to the pattern analysis of Sanjiang plainmarsh, the study area. Two temporal vecctor-based data sets of the study area come from interpretation of remote sens-ingimages MSS (1980) and TM (2000). Theaplication of the theory captures some shape properties of riparian wet-land in Sanjiangplain marsh. The dissymmetrktl featires of Sanjiang plain marsh around principal axes due to agricul-tural development could also be explained.
